PostgreSQL
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> PostgreSQL

Sao chép bảng từ cơ sở dữ liệu này sang cơ sở dữ liệu khác trong Postgres

Trích xuất bảng và chuyển trực tiếp đến cơ sở dữ liệu đích:

pg_dump -t table_to_copy source_db | psql target_db

Lưu ý: Nếu cơ sở dữ liệu khác đã thiết lập bảng, bạn nên sử dụng -a gắn cờ để chỉ nhập dữ liệu, nếu không, bạn có thể thấy các lỗi lạ như "Hết bộ nhớ":

pg_dump -a -t my_table my_db | psql target_db


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. SQL Điền bảng với dữ liệu ngẫu nhiên

  2. PostgreSQL Logical Replication Gotchas

  3. Cột PostgreSQL 'foo' không tồn tại

  4. Công bố Barman 1.0, Trình quản lý sao lưu và phục hồi cho PostgreSQL

  5. Vectơ địa lý ST_HexagonGrid để tìm tất cả các điểm